U.S. Historical Usage
The name Ayhem was first seen in the United States in 2007.
Ayhem has ranked as high as #1385 nationally, which occurred in 2022, and has been most popular in .
In the past 5 years the name Ayhem has been trending up compared to the previous 5 years.

Popularity Over Time (National) — Table
We track the national popularity of each baby name annually. The table below displays each year along with the number of births reported by the Social Security Administration. This data combines all state-level reporting from the SSA's baby names database to provide a comprehensive view of overall birth counts for Ayhem.
| Year | Births |
|---|---|
| 2022 | 8 |
| 2021 | 7 |
| 2018 | 5 |
| 2013 | 6 |
| 2012 | 6 |
| 2011 | 7 |
| 2010 | 5 |
| 2008 | 5 |
| 2007 | 5 |
